Output 506997e13ef81601b628908604e51329d3f13bc26290143963c1d88790731e1f:3

value
43712774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ebd532d033db89167f0844074808bd4151ccd7d OP_EQUAL
address
3GAMVNstsGbXAcfogx8xhncRkjQZgWuKoe
transaction
506997e13ef81601b628908604e51329d3f13bc26290143963c1d88790731e1f
spent
true